Transaction ea96506683f9183f0ee8701a2792d78f25fdd8a772c8ea14ca8f411b00970c71
1 Input
1 Output
-
ea96506683f9183f0ee8701a2792d78f25fdd8a772c8ea14ca8f411b00970c71:0
- value
- 1371606
- script pubkey
- OP_0 OP_PUSHBYTES_20 655492512dc1728431054ac8a6e95fa38ae1ede7
- address
- bc1qv42fy5fdc9eggvg9fty2d62l5w9wrm08wzhwzy